1. An asymmetric convex mirror lens, comprising:

  • an asymmetric convex mirror dome lens having a peripheral edge which defines a width-wise extending axis and an height-wise extending axis and a plurality of sections of constant radius of curvature arranged width-wise along the mirror dome lens, said convex mirror dome lens comprising;

    a first section having a first constant radius of curvature, located to one side relative to the height-wise axis of the mirror dome lens;

    a second section having a second constant radius of curvature which is different from the first constant radius of curvature, located to the left of the height-wise extending axis of the mirror dome lens; and

    at least one third section having a third constant radius of curvature which is different from the first and second constant radius of curvature and joined to, and in between, said first and second sections,wherein the mirror dome lens defines a base with the peripheral edge lying in a flat plane, the peripheral edge of the base asymmetrically shaped and which is neither circular, nor oval, nor elliptical in shape and is asymmetric with respect to both the width-wise extending axis and the height-wise extending axis.
